Send a Peppol invoice. The API validates the payload against BIS 3.0 business rules, generates UBL XML, and delivers it to the buyer's access point.
Parties
Your API key determines the seller/legal entity. The payload must include to (buyer) with name, peppolId, street, city, postalCode, and country. The deprecated from field is ignored by the gateway and kept only for local/offline compatibility.

Each line needs description, quantity, unitPrice, and vatRate. An optional vatCategory sets the UBL tax category (defaults to standard VAT). Amounts are calculated automatically — no need for manual totals.
vatCategory accepts "S" (standard), "Z" (zero-rated), "E" (exempt), "AE" (reverse charge), "K" (intra-community), "G" (export) and "O" (outside scope). Codes are case-sensitive: "AE" is reverse charge, "ae" is rejected. Omit the field to take the default — a value you supply is never silently corrected.

Add paymentTerms and paymentIban to include payment instructions. Strongly recommended for Belgian and French mandates.
GET /v1/invoices/{id}/as/original answers 404 on a document that is perfectly healthy — the stored copy is still being registered. Fetching it synchronously right after a send therefore looks like a failure; poll rather than assuming one retry is enough, since no bound on that window is guaranteed. It does not wait for delivery: the document is downloadable well before the receiving access point has signed for it. To know that delivery actually happened, read the status from GET /v1/invoices/{id} — available immediately — or wait for the invoice.sent webhook.Parameters

Attach supporting documents to your invoices — PDF copies, timesheets, contracts, or any file. Supports both embedded (base64) and external URL references.
Embedded
Provide filename, mimeType, and raw base64-encoded content without a data URI prefix. The file is included directly in the UBL XML.
External URL
Provide a url instead. The buyer's access point will fetch the document. Make sure the URL is publicly accessible.

Apply discounts (allowances) and surcharges to invoices at both the document level and line level.
Document-level
Use allowances for discounts and charges for surcharges that apply to the entire invoice. Each requires reason, amount, and vatRate.
Line-level
Add allowances or charges to individual line items. Line-level adjustments only need reason and amount.

Specify delivery details and billing periods for invoices that cover goods delivery or service periods.
Delivery
Add a delivery object with an optional date and address. Some EU countries (e.g. Italy, Spain) require delivery information on invoices.
Invoice Period
Use invoicePeriod with startDate and endDate for subscriptions, retainers, or any service billed over a time range.

Most failures on this endpoint fall into one of these categories. The API returns structured JSON with a stable error field and (where available) a machine-readable code for client-side branching. See Error Handling for the full reference.
Validation failed (422)
One or more fields failed Peppol BIS 3.0 validation. Common causes: missing buyer address (BR-50/51/53), invalid VAT rate (BR-CO-17), malformed Peppol ID, or unknown currency code.

Returned when x-validate-recipient: strict is set and the recipient's Peppol ID is not registered. Verify with GET /v1/directory/{scheme}/{id} first.

Sandbox limit is 10 req/min per key. The response includes a Retry-After header with the seconds to wait. The SDK retries automatically with exponential backoff.
